Breakdown of SWIFT Code SAIBJPJT.
The breakdown of the SWIFT Code SAIBJPJT is as follows,
SAIB - The first four letters represent the unique code for SAITAMA RESONA BANK, LIMITED.
JP - JP is the next two letters that represent the Country code, In this case, it’s Japan.
JT - JT is the last two letters are the branch Code.
